Azure Arc allows you to manage on-premises resources like servers from Azure. This is a powerful feature that can help streamline the management process of hybrid environments, but it also further blurs the security boundary between your on-premises landscape and Azure. Event based retention is now generally available to help organizations manage retention of content based on events. Whether an employee departure, or the close of a project, you can now establish specific event triggers and apply retention or deletion policies associated to those events.
